Contents: Epitranscriptomic modifications (m6A, m5C and ac4c modifications) -- mRNA epitranscriptomic modification -- Loss of m6A modifiers and IVA replication -- m6A modifiers: YTHDF proteins and METTL3 -- Epitranscriptomic modifications in HIV-1 -- m5C modifiers: NSUN2 -- ac4c modifiers: NAT10 -- m6A and ac4c increase viral mRNA stability while m5C increases viral mRNA translation.
